      <description>&lt;p&gt;I purchased this charger along with two deep discharge marine batteries that I use to power a winch. &#160;The winch is based on a truck starter motor. &#160;The winch is used to launch radio controlled sailplanes which have a wing span of 6-12 feet. &#160;A launch can pull anywhere from 250 to 500 amps for a period of 5 to 15 seconds. &#160;So the batteries take a beating.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;The charger does an excellent job of recharging them AND maintaining their charge level. &#160;They never go in a car or boat so this is the only charge method.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;I find the meter useful and like the green light that indicates fully charged. &#160;I only have to glance at the charger to know that my battery is fully charged and ready to go.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;I have never used the 50 amp position.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;When not in use, the power cord and charge cord store easily on the back of the charger.&lt;/p&gt;... </description>

      <description>&lt;p&gt; I've read every review on this charger and what struck me the most was the fact that I appear to be the only person who can't make any sense out of the charger meter.  What planet did the designer of this meter come from? &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;There appears to be charge rates indicated along the bottom of the meter marked 0.. 2.. 4.. 6.. 8.. 10.. and 12, which is a bit strange for a charger that has advertized rates of 2 amps, 10 amps and 50 amps.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Then there is the long rectangular bar at the top of the meter with the left 2/3rds of the bar colored green and the right 1/3 side colored red.  The green portion is labeled &quot;2 Amp Rate&quot; and the right (red) side is marked &quot;Start&quot;.  If that isn't confusing enough, there is a pie shaped sliver of red within the green area, which more or less lines up with the 2 amp rate indicator at the bottom of the meter.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;To round out the mass confusion of this meter there is a Charge% line just below the green and red rectangular bar.  The markings begin at about the halfway point...&lt;/p&gt;... </description>
